The role of a Functional Assessor is to conduct medical assessments and examinations and produce concise reports for the Department of Work and Pensions (DWP) as part of a successful integrated team.


You would not be asked to make a decision on whether or not the customer should receive benefits, you would only be asked to conduct a holistic and clinical assessment on the customer, collating all the information into a report for the DWP.


M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• To undertake a combination of file-work and face-to-face assessments of customers in relation to a variety of benefits and provide a report to the DWP. File-work involves reviewing medical evidence in a written or electronic format to determine the suitability of a face-to-face assessment. Such assessments focus on how a disability affects a customer`s day to day life in performing work related activities. These assessments may be recorded.

  • To use IT software programmes to support clinical decision making when undertaking file-work and examinations.

  • To provide comprehensive reports to enable decision makers at DWP to make informed decisions regarding benefit claims.
